Sweet Peas are pretty tough and can handle a little frost, but I am now so distrustful of our Bozeman frost dates that I'm experimenting with just about EVERYTHING indoors to assure that they mature fully before the FALL frost.

These particular seeds are meant for containers which I hadn't seen before. They'll grow to between 3' to 4' so I'm hopeful a large container with a creative, small trellis will make for a stunning and unusual summer surprise.

So that's the experiment for this week. So far so good....and I'll keep you posted!
